What a great morning for a race!!!!  I'm in New Mexico to race with my beautiful sister-in-law, Kristina; and spend Easter and Spring Break with my family.  I met Kristina at the race this morning and we took a lap around the track to warm up and then stretched out.  It was an out and back course with a downhill in the beginning and uphill, of course, on the home stretch.  We started out at a pretty quick pace and I was worried that we might fizzle out; but the downhill allowed us to keep it up.  By the time we turned around, we were good and warmed up and ready for a harder push.  We had one lady pass us toward the end, but we kicked it up and passed her before the finish line! 

I was sooooo darn proud of Kristina!!!!  This was the longest continuous run she's done since having a baby - and she held strong the whole way!!!  She thought that she would be happy with 40 minutes, and really happy with 35 -- so, 31 blew us both away!!  I'm not sure if I was as good a pacer for her as Lybi was for me - but the results were still great!  Running with family brings out the best in us!!!  It was very fun to see both our families, her parents, and my parents at the finish line.  

 
Afterwards, I ran 3.7 more miles with my sweet husband to make today a good mileage for Saturday.  I think 7 miles is a bit of a round-up; the actual mileage was closer to 6.97, but who cares about a .03?  (hee,hee)
